Description

2,4-Dichloro-n-Methoxy-n-Methylbenzamide is a specialized benzamide derivative with a defined halogenated and methoxylated structure, serving as a key synthetic intermediate. This compound matters for its role in facilitating complex organic syntheses, particularly in the development of advanced chemical entities. It is primarily needed by research institutions and industrial manufacturers in the pharmaceutical and agrochemical sectors for the synthesis of novel active ingredients and fine chemicals.

Basic Information

Product Name 2,4-Dichloro-n-Methoxy-n-Methylbenzamide
CAS No. 646528-36-1
Molecular Formula C10H11Cl2NO2
Molecular Weight 248.10 g/mol
Synonyms 2,4-Dichloro-N-methoxy-N-methylbenzamide; N-Methoxy-N-methyl-2,4-dichlorobenzamide; 2,4-Dichlorobenzoic Acid N-Methoxy-N-Methylamide; N-Methoxy-N,2,4-trichlorobenzamide; 646528-36-1; Benzamide, 2,4-dichloro-N-methoxy-N-methyl-; N-Methoxy-N-methyl-2,4-dichlorobenzamide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ials and sources of ignition.
